The Tester is a member of a team which plans, constructs, and executes product tests, system tests, unit tests, load tests, volume tests, network tests as well as works with others for release control processes. The more experienced Tester manages, plans, constructs, and executes tests and integrates with release control process.

Role Description:

Reviews and understands the Test Team work plan.

Assists in managing and directing Test Team processes.

Anticipates, identifies, tracks, and resolves issues and risks affecting own work and work of the Test and/or Application Teams.

Develops contingency plans as necessary.

Researches problems before approaching the Team Lead or Test Team Lead for assistance.

Assists or guides Testers as needed.

Develops understanding of system business requirements supported by the Test team

Assists Application Teams to plan and execute component and assembly tests.

Participates in assembly or product test execution as required.

Defines product test plans and criteria for acceptance.

Develops, updates, and maintains testing standards and procedures.

Resolves testing process questions / issues.

Assists in the planning, creation, and control of the test environments.

Conducts inspections; resolve issues.

Coordinates and executes assembly or product tests with the Test Team, Application Team and the Program Manager.

Assists Team Lead or Test Team Lead in monitoring estimated-time-to-complete

(ETC) and actuals for assigned tasks.

Works with Test Team members to enhance their testing skills and build technical and Updates and tests release installation procedures.

Generally aware of new developments in industry and processes and ability to apply to work as appropriate.

Determines time estimates and schedule for work efforts.

Defines and utilizes entry / exit criteria for testing.

Schedules the design of structured walk-throughs or inspections; resolve issues.

Works with users to ensure that solutions meet business requirements.

Anticipates and resolves issues specific to the team.

Determines time estimates and schedule for own work and resolve issues in a timely manner.

Identifies and tracks issues, risks, and action items.

Creates test models for product test and release control (plans, data, and scripts).

Conducts structured walk-throughs

Executes assembly or product tests.

Meets time estimates for assigned tasks.

Communicates accurate and useful status updates.

Follows quality standards.

Able to work in a team environment

Completes assigned tasks.

Exceptional communication skills; both written and spoken
